This typeface shows clear, bracketed serifs and a pronounced stroke-contrast that gives letters a crisp, engraved feel. Curves are smooth and slightly elastic, while straight stems remain firm, producing a steady vertical rhythm in text. Counters are moderately open, with compact, sturdy lowercase forms and tidy joins that stay clean at reading sizes. The uppercase has a traditional proportion and presence, and the numerals share the same sharp, high-contrast structure with confident terminals.

The design maintains consistent serif shaping across caps, lowercase, and figures, helping paragraphs feel cohesive. Rounded letters (like o/c/e) keep a smooth, controlled curvature, while diagonals (like v/w/x/y) appear taut and well-balanced, reinforcing a disciplined texture in text.
